- Contents
- The origin and enactment of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 / David B. Filvaroff and Raymond E. Wolfinger -- What light does the Civil Rights Act of 1875 shed on the Civil Rights Act of 1964 / J. Morgan Kousser -- The Civil Rights Act and the American regulatory state / Hugh Davis Graham -- Litigation and lobbying as complementary strategies for civil rights / Stephen L. Wasby -- A personal reflection on civil rights enforcement and the civil rights agenda / Jack Greenberg -- The 1964 Civil Rights Act and American education / Gary Orfield -- The impact of EEO law: a social movement perspective / Paul Burstein -- The struggle for racial equality in public accommodations / Randall Kennedy -- Changing hearts and minds: racial attitudes and civil rights / Katherine Tate and Gloria J. Hampton -- Civil rights in a multicultural society / Luis Ricardo Fraga and Jorge Ruiz-de-Velasco -- The fife and drum march to the nineteenth century: thoughts on the emerging separate but equal doctrine / Barbara Phillips Sullivan -- Civil rights, the Constitution, common decency, and common sense / Bernard Grofman -- Afterword: U.S. Civil rights policies in comparative perspective / Robin M. Williams, Jr.
